GameStop Corp. Form 8-K Summary
Business Context and Reporting Period
This Current Report on Form 8-K was filed by GameStop Corp. on February 9, 2011. The report addresses corporate governance changes regarding executive employment agreements rather than operational or financial performance for a specific fiscal period.

Material Changes
On February 9, 2011, the Company amended Executive Employment Agreements for five key officers: R. Richard Fontaine, Daniel A. DeMatteo, J. Paul Raines, Tony D. Bartel, and Robert A. Lloyd. The material changes include:
- Elimination of the right for each executive to terminate their employment agreement as a result of a change-in-control of the Company.
- Elimination of the automatic renewal provision for each agreement, with the exception of Mr. Fontaine, whose agreement did not contain such a provision.
